"In the Spirit of Martin: The Living Legacy of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r."
- the first major Smithsonian exhibition of visual arts dedicated to
celebrating this American hero - features 120 works by prominent and
emerging artists, including folk artists. The exhibition is a visual
testament to the enduring power of King's life and work.
Circulated by the Smithsonian Institution Traveling Exhibition Service
(SITES), "In the Spirit of Martin" will open at the Charles H. Wright
Museum of African American History in Detroit on January 13, 2002, and
